Grampian race conference attracts big names
20 Apr 05
120 delegates from across the country attend conference on race relations issues
Representatives from the criminal justice system, teachers and police are to attend a conference to discuss race relations issues facing Scotland in Dundee today.
The event, organised by Grampian Racial Equality Council, will focus on preventing and responding to racist incidents.
Keynote speakers include Elish Angiolini QC, Solicitor General for Scotland, and Les Davey, Director of Real Justice UK and Ireland.
Mrs Angiolini will underline Scotland's prosecutors' commitment to a vigorous anti-racist stance and to the prosecution of racist crime.
